About this book

This book provides an extensive analysis of the law and practice relating to insolvency litigation in England and Wales, as well as examination of other common law jurisdictions. Written by leading insolvency lawyers it addresses key concerns affecting the prosecution and defence of insolvency proceedings by drawing on a wide range of case law, providing detailed guidance on challenging issues. Key Features: Combines practice insights with a clear exposition of the relevant law as it affects the litigation relating to insolvency proceedings Focuses on the law in England and Wales but incorporates consideration of law in other common law jurisdictions Evaluates the Insolvency Rules 2016 and the Insolvency Act 1986 in the context of relevant case law Examines a broad range of litigation topics, including insolvency processes, information gathering, claims, costs and funding, and cross-border regulations Insolvency Litigation is a vital resource for legal practitioners specialising in insolvency, as well as all those seeking a wider understanding of insolvency litigation. Its insights are also beneficial to students and scholars of company and insolvency law, and dispute resolution.
